FC Goa secured a spot in the semi-finals of the Bhausaheb Bandodkar Memorial Trophy 2024 after defeating Dempo SC 2-1 in their final group stage match, marking a perfect record in the group. Armando Sadiku opened the scoring for Goa in the 16th minute, but Dempo equalized through Shubham Rawat in the 58th minute before Ayush Chhetri restored Goa's lead shortly after. Meanwhile, Brisbane Roar also advanced to the semi-finals with a 2-0 victory over Sporting Clube de Goa, finishing second in Group A. In a previous match, FC Goa achieved a historic 1-0 win against Brisbane Roar, becoming the first Indian Super League club to defeat an A-League team. The match was marked by a red card for Brisbane's Benjamin Halloran, which shifted the momentum in Goa's favor. Coach Manolo Marquez expressed concerns over player performance despite the victories, emphasizing the need for improvement ahead of the Indian Super League season.
